About Adam Cruz

Berklee identifies Cruz as a New York-born drummer and composer whose 1990s work included David Sánchez, the Mingus Big Band, Chick Corea, and Charlie Hunter. The faculty profile also documents his sustained role in pianist Danilo Pérez’s trio with bassist Ben Street.[1]

Cruz’s curated professional profile adds his Rutgers and New School training and teaching roles at City College of New York and the Berklee Global Jazz Institute. Both biographies distinguish this ensemble and educational work from Milestone, his first leader recording as a composer.[1][2]

The artist-run Milestone Bandcamp streams the eight-track 2011 Sunnyside album and credits Cruz as drummer, composer, arranger, and producer. It provides a first-party record of the leader project rather than treating his sideman catalog as his own group.[3]

Danilo Pérez Trio

Berklee documents Cruz’s long-running trio relationship with Pérez and bassist Ben Street.[1]

Milestone

The eight-track leader album presents Cruz’s compositions, arrangements, drums, and production under his own name.[3]

New York and Berklee teaching

His professional profile records educator roles at City College of New York and Berklee’s Global Jazz Institute.[2]
